如何在Laravel中使用php执行psql命令

时间:2018-06-16 00:22:26

标签: php postgresql nginx psql

我尝试做这样的事情:

shell_exec(" psql -U postgres -d database -f /home/ubuntux86/pgsl/read.sql")

它在Laravel(Nginx)中不起作用,但在终端

中工作

并尝试授予www-data

在SCHEMA public TO" www-data";

的所有表格上授予所有特权

它仍然不起作用。

我想要执行命令\ copy,但它无法使用DB :: select()

是否只能用psql执行\ copy?

0 个答案:

没有答案